Driving Success through Guest Satisfaction and Operational Excellence Episode 6 | 12/12/24 Episode Overview How do you take a struggling brand and turn it into an industry leader? A Restaurant Turnaround Strategy- just ask Roger Gondek. With over 40 years in the restaurant industry—Gondek joined Twin Peaks in 2016 with a clear mission. This isn’t just a success story—it’s a blueprint for any restaurant looking to thrive. We break down the specifics of their Restaurant Turnaround Strategy. Key Takeaways: [Insight #1] – Guest Feedback as the Heart of Success Collecting and acting on guest feedback helps improve operations and guest experience. Make Feedback Easy with simple tools, like QR-code business cards, encourage guests to leave reviews. [Insight #2] – The Power of Staffing: A Foundational Element Well-staffed restaurants deliver faster service, raise employee morale, improve guest experience, and, therefore, boost sales. [Insight #3] – Operational Excellence Meets Data-Driven Incentives Bonuses tied to guest sentiment scores motivate managers to focus on exceptional service and accountability. Mentioned in the Episode: Winning with Guest Feedback: Twin Peaks’ Restaurant Turnaround Strategy for Success Turn Feedback to $. Accurately Size Financial Impact of Guest Experience. Twin Peaks had consistent double-digit sales growth and a post-COVID comeback.…

How Marketing Leaders at Keke’s Breakfast Cafe and Velvet Taco Drive Wide-Spread ASR Improvement Episode 5 | 11/21/24 Episode Overview For restaurant brands, understanding and acting on guest feedback is no longer optional. It’s a critical factor in driving sales, improving operations, and brand health. In a recent Lesson from the Field, industry leaders from Keke’s Breakfast Cafe and Velvet Taco shared how reviews shape the future of restaurants. Here are the key takeaways of how they use feedback to drive success. Key Takeaways: [Insight #1] – The Correlation Between ASR & Sales Research shows that even a half-star improvement in ASR can lead to substantial sales growth. [Insight #2] – Guest Reviews are a Key Local Marketing Channel Guest reviews now serve as a primary tool for showcasing quality and connecting with the community. [Insight #3] – Guest Feedback is a Predictor of Sales and Traffic Guest feedback is a treasure trove of data and a predictor of how a restaurant unit is going to perform in the future. Restaurants can use feedback to: Identify trends Make proactive adjustments Plan marketing strategies [Insight #4] – Guest Feedback is a Source of Insight Against the Competition Guest feedback helps brands gauge their performance against competitors. Identify areas where you outperform competitors and protect those strengths. Regional insights can also help brands adapt strategies to local markets. Gen Now: Overcoming Challenges with Today’s Multi-Generational Workforce Episode 2 | Originally posted 03/07/24 Episode Overview With Baby boomers retiring, Gen Z, a force of 68 million, is entering the workforce, leading among hourly workers. This shift urges restaurants to rethink their approach to attracting and retaining employees. In 2024, restaurants focus on developing frontline managers to meet the demands of a rapidly changing workforce. Key Takeaways: [Insight #1] – Most restaurants remain understaffed. [Insight #2] – Salary is the #1 factor drawing Gen Zs to a job. [Insight #3] – The majority of hourly new hires are Gen Zs. [Insight #4] – Workplace benefits and training play a pivotal role in employee retention. As if the restaurant industry hasn’t faced enough staffing challenges, another dilemma has been added to their plate. With the largest generation in American history exiting the workforce, employers are racing against time to fill the gap with the next batch of workers: Gen Zs. But as more of this generation enters the talent pool, they bring a new set of challenges, values, and expectations. This means restaurants may have to adjust their approach to remain competitive in attracting this new segment of the workforce. Breaking Down the Casual Dining Chain’s 360-View of the Restaurant Experience Episode 3 | 12/14/23 Episode Overview Huddle House, a thriving casual dining chain in the US, has cultivated a culture of valuing feedback. They proactively gather customer insights at every touchpoint during the dining experience. Whether guests choose to order online, opt for curbside pickup, dine-in, or have their meals delivered, the Huddle House team diligently examines and leverages this feedback to constantly elevate their brand experience and ensure they consistently meet guest expectations.
